Wages for Kindergarten/Preschool Education and Teaching Jobs in Michigan

In this state, kindergarten/preschool education and teaching grads earn an average of $35,010. Nationwide, they make an average of $34,410.

Kindergarten/Preschool Education and Teaching Careers in MI

Some of the careers kindergarten/preschool education and teaching majors go into include:

Job Title MI Job Growth MI Median Salary
Preschool Teachers 12% $31,390
Kindergarten Teachers 9% $58,930
